Patient call wait times at University Hospitals Sussex have been cut by up to 90% since the implementation of AI technology from Netcall.
The NHS is planning to ramp up the use of AI tools through the FDP, including products to support theatre scheduling, triage and discharge.

Patients across England can now check referrals and appointments through the NHS App after it was connected to every acute NHS trust.

AI-scribing tool G2 Speech has been recognised as a self-certified supplier on the NHS England ambient voice technology (AVT) registry.
